Output 43268307b42e99d0fbd54746a673ec35cde8fbcf8856cb784d0d9c0f3a5720b9:0

value
579709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a55e531774c9146d691c4ad244f5c30f90a3c88 OP_EQUALVERIFY OP_CHECKSIG
address
1DcT9ajqfHpZYzL7M8tzQA6FMKT9drjBp3
transaction
43268307b42e99d0fbd54746a673ec35cde8fbcf8856cb784d0d9c0f3a5720b9
spent
true